Malnutrition

Malnutrition is a serious health condition that occurs when:

  • A person’s diet lacks essential nutrients for proper body function
  • The body cannot properly absorb or utilize nutrients from food
    It affects individuals of all ages and can stem from poor diet, illness, or a combination of both.

Types of Malnutrition

  1. Undernutrition (most common in developing countries)
    • Wasting (low weight-for-height)
    • Stunting (low height-for-age in children)
    • Underweight (low weight-for-age)
  2. Micronutrient Deficiencies
    • Lack of vital vitamins/minerals (iron, vitamin A, iodine, etc.)
  3. Overnutrition
    • Obesity and diet-related diseases (common in developed nations)

Effects of Malnutrition

  • Children:
    • Impaired physical/cognitive development
    • Weakened immune system → higher infection risk
  • Adults:
    • Reduced work capacity
    • Increased risk of chronic diseases (diabetes, heart disease)
  • Elderly:
    • Muscle loss, slower recovery from illness

Causes of Malnutrition

  • Poverty/lack of access to nutritious food
  • Poor dietary diversity
  • Digestive disorders (celiac disease, Crohn’s)
  • Mental health issues (eating disorders, depression)
  • Food insecurity (famine, conflict)

Solutions & Prevention

✅ Food-Based Approaches:

  • Promoting nutrient-rich foods (fruits, vegetables, proteins)
  • Food fortification programs (e.g., iodized salt)

✅ Healthcare Strategies:

  • Early screening and intervention
  • Therapeutic foods for severe cases

✅ Education & Support:

  • Nutrition counseling
  • Community feeding programs
  • Breastfeeding promotion for infants

Why It Matters

Addressing malnutrition is critical for:

  • Healthy child development
  • Reducing disease burden
  • Improving life expectancy and quality of life
